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ned. Permit Process and System Operation Coordinates function of department Permit Center, including development and building permit application intake,customer interaction management,permit review workflow,fee management,and permit issuance and tracking. Prioritizes and facilitates continuous improvement of permit system,including workflow processes and customer interactions. Coordinates maintenance and update of permit database workflows and fees. Maintains and updates paper and electronic application forms. Updates department website as needed with a focus on Permit Center components. Serves as lead department staff for operation and maintenance of permitting software,which is a Tyler Technologies product called"EnerGov,"including connection with Laserfiche file storage database.Acts as liaison to other county departments for EnerGov and Laserfiche database management. Monitors and facilitates customer self-service interactions through EnerGov. Maintains and coordinates customer appointment calendars including but not limited to building permit intake calendar,and customer assistance meeting calendar for planning and building plans examiner. Acts as liaison for department management and staff by interacting with customers to ascertain individual need.Provides information to customers,as needed. Routes work to appropriate staff members for resolution when warranted. Subjects may be technical in nature. Collaborates with staff to ensure reception,telephone,email,and other customer service responsibilities are managed within established response time and quality benchmarks. Maintains flow of administrative paperwork to and from the Department. Ensures timeline requirements of the departmental benchmark for internal and external correspondence are met. Files and indexes routine correspondence, reports,and other material according to a prescribed breakdown. Assists permit technicians;audits work of permit technicians;audits files to insure permit technicians have required understanding of filing and tracking processes. Limited legal understanding of permitting processes. Monitors employees for compliance with departmental policies, procedures, regulatory requirements and standards of service. Monitors overall Permit Center workload and advises department management of problem areas on an on-going basis. Trains front office staff,answers questions, provides guidance, and fills in when and where needed. As requested,assists Building Inspectors and Code Compliance Coordinator with site visits for compliance and built-without-permit cases needing further investigation for permitting paths. Assists in special projects which may include research,acting as a member of a team,workflow creation and data entry. Administrative Support Assists Administrative Services Manager with a variety of department administrative tasks, including cashiering, accounts payable,records and file management,payroll,and related responsibilities. As directed by Administrative Services Manager, assists with planning and coordinating administrative functions, including preparation of department payroll for approval submittal; performance of billing function through review, preparation, and electronic input of bills, invoices, vouchers. purchase orders, using the Tyler Technologies accounts payable software; and assistance with daily deposits and transmittal reconciliation. Handles a variety of confidential documents and correspondence while performing secretarial and administrative work for the Director and staff of the Department. Assists Administrative Services Manager with monitoring supply usage, ensuring supplies are ordered as needed, and tracking and handling service on office equipment. As directed, schedules and coordinates travel, workshop, and training arrangements for department staff.Plans,schedules and coordinates meetings and necessary equipment for meetings, as needed. Compiles information, researches, and distributes information from administrative records and transactions. Performs file searches as necessary. Researches, composes, and/or prepares correspondence, reports, documents, notifications, and memos from standard layouts and formats. using judgment and inserting own contents as authorized and required. Assists Administrative Services Manager with records management. Compiles, stores,organizes, and prepares public records and releases such information in response to requests for public information, as directed. Works with department management and staff to create and maintain standard operating procedures. Assists with onboarding new staff as directed. S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ES:This position has no supervisory responsibilities; however, it does function as a lead position within the department.The lead assigns, monitors, and reviews the work of other employees in administrative or permit technician positions. Assist the Director with interviewing, training, planning, assigning, and directing the work of other department positions. Persons in this position are expected to plan their own work within a structured environment and may edit the work of co-workers.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: To perform this job successfully an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ge. skill. and/or ability required.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ions. E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E Associates degree(A.A.)or equivalent from two-year college or technical school:and three (3) years' experience in progressively responsible clerical positions, including two (2) years' experience as an Administrative Assistant and two (2) years' experience as a Permit Technician or equivalent combination of education and experience. Must pass Criminal History Background Check. LANGUAGE SKILLS Ability to read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operating and ma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als. Ability to write routine reports and correspondence. Ability to speak effectively before groups and customers or employees of organization. MATHEMATICAL SKILLS Ability to calculate figures and amounts such as discounts, interest, commissions, proportions. percentages. area,circumference, and volume. Ability to apply concepts of basic algebra and geometry. REASONING ABILITY Ability to apply common sense understanding to carry out instructions furnished in written, oral. or diagram form. Ability to deal with problems involving several concrete variables in standardized situations. COMPUTER SKILLS To perform this job successfully an individual should have knowledge of Accounting software; Permit software, Microsoft operating platform, Adobe.
